A well-structured business case serves as a cornerstone in securing funding for new initiatives. It details the rationale behind a proposed project, showcasing its potential benefits and addressing potential roadblocks. Crafting a compelling business case requires a structured approach that encompasses key elements.
- Begin by specifying the problem or opportunity your initiative aims to address.
- Carry out thorough market research and evaluate industry trends to validate your claims.
- Formulate a detailed plan outlining the aims of the project and the steps required for its successful implementation.
- Project the financial implications associated with your proposal, and formulate a realistic financial model to illustrate its profitability or return on investment (ROI).
- Convey your findings effectively using visual aids to simplify complex information.
By following these steps, you can develop a business case that is persuasive, driving success for securing the necessary resources to bring your ideas to fruition.

Developing The Essential Elements of an Effective Business Case
A compelling business case is the core for any successful more info project or initiative. It serves as a roadmap to justify resources and motivate stakeholders towards a shared vision. When crafting an effective business case, several key elements must be considered. A clearly defined problem statement sets the stage for your proposal. By highlighting the current issues, you demonstrate the urgency for change.
Furthermore, a comprehensive analysis of potential alternatives is essential. Evaluate each solution based on its viability and consequences. Provide a detailed forecast of costs, outcomes, and the timeline for implementation.
- Communicating your findings in a clear, concise, and convincing manner is crucial. Use data, statistics to validate your arguments and capture the attention of your audience.
- Addressing potential obstacles and outlining prevention strategies builds trust.
- Finally, a well-structured business case should reinforce its central message and recommendation for moving forward.
